What's Next?

So the big question on everyone's mind is... "when can you bring little Deanna home"?

Right now I'm in another waiting phase. I'm waiting for my Travel Approval (TA) from China. Once I have TA, the agency can make my Consulate Appointment (CA). The travel will be scheduled around the CA appointment. So right now, I'm still waiting for the TA and there isn't much new news until that is ready.

But this time, I don't mind the wait at all. While the 3 years of waiting was painful, I am ok with this part of the wait. (Or at least I am today. If it goes on too long then I may have a different story.) The most likely scenario is that our group will travel to China at the end of October and be home the first week in November. It could be faster than that, but probably not much slower.

Today is September 1st. For more than 3 years, I've been on an incredible journey to begin my family. This long wait has been difficult, but my dreams will be coming true in a very short while.

Somewhere, halfway around the world, the CCAA has matched me and a child and we are already a family. Isn't that amazing?

The CCAA (China Center for Adoption Affairs) sends out referrals once a month and we are in the next batch. Rumors say that those referrals are in the air via DHL already. That means I will see my precious daughter's face in a number of days. I've waited 3 years, but these last few days are killing me. But it is so worth it.
